Rookie Speedcar Racer joins the SSS!
30/09/2007 - SSS PR

 

With nominations opening for the Speedcar Super Series only a week ago, drivers are signing on for what looks to be one of the best series’ to date. The first nomination sees a rookie Midget campaigner from Western Australia joining the 07/08 tour; Brett Matherson!

Recording an impressive history in the NSW GP Midget division including multiple podium placings in both the Australian and NSW Titles before moving west to Perth, Brett is joining the series in his new Spike/Brayton Gaerte machinery.

“I’m looking forward to hitting the road on the SSS and gaining valuable track time and experience” says an eager Matherson on confirming his involvement. “The only way I can do that is by racing with the best at a variety of tracks, which will give me the experience to adapt quickly to the constant changing conditions that is speedway racing."

“With our main sponsor MCS Technology becoming naming right sponsor of the SSS Pole Shuffle this year, we wanted to be on the series too. We’ve invested a lot of money including a new spike chassis, but without the ongoing assistance from my brother Scott and Mark Cooper from American Tire & Racing Services this wouldn’t be possible, as they helping to co-ordinate my efforts on the East coast”.

Brett is planning on debuting his new ride at the opening Speedcar race meeting at Sydney’s TPCR on October 13th in preparation for the SSS opening round on November 3rd.

“I must say a special thank you to Robert Marfia from the US as he has played a big part in supplying us with our fresh Brayton Gaerte and arranging the air shipment overnight including an emergency run to the Albuquerque International Airport (some 45 minutes from his workshop) to allow us to make the new PCR season to sort out any teething issues before the SSS on Nov 3rd."

“US-based Blake Robertson has been invaluable by providing parts at such short notice which will enable us to have the car available by October 13th. I can’t thank BR Motorsports and our other sponsors MCS Technology, American Tires & Racing Services, and The Speedway Shop enough for their support.

“At the end of the day, the SSS is our national series and that’s where I want to be”.
